如何在单元格中的文本之间添加垂直线,vba excel

时间:2013-07-12 18:08:29

标签: excel vba line

例如,现在我有一个像这样的单元格:

enter image description here

但我想要这样。

enter image description here

excel VBA有可能吗? 谢谢!!

2 个答案:

答案 0 :(得分:4)

使用“数据”选项卡下的“文本到列”功能将其分为2列。然后,如果您确实需要一条线,请选择最后一列并添加左边框。

答案 1 :(得分:1)

这些数据是否都在一个单元格中?

无论有没有VBA,你都很难让它正确对齐 - 每个角色占据的宽度略有不同。 已编辑嗯,正如Tim Williams所建议的那样,使用固定宽度的字体可能会表现得更好,但我仍然怀疑它是否能够始终如一地运作。 (您只能插入空格和管道'|'字符,但它不会正确排列。)

此数据属于两列,多行,两行之间有边框。